The winners of the Wine Laid Bare charity photographic competition were announced at Johannesburg Wine Show. The competition, in support of breast cancer, saw amateur and professional photographers submet their interpretations of the theme in the hope that their shots will make the calendar that is sold for R100 to raise funds for Cansa.
“Since its launch in 2009, Wine Laid Bare has seen many cancer survivors participate in the competition. Once again we have been overwhelmed by the response from photographers, models, and wine loving South Africans who were willing to bare it all in a tasteful interpretation of the theme and in aid of breast cancer awareness,” says organiser and founder of The Wine Show, John Woodward.
The winning photos were submitted by Randall Spruit (January), Graphic Art (February), Robert Russell (March), Gunther Swart (April and May), Lucien Desmarais (June), Theuns Coetzee (July and August), Riaan Swanepoel (September), Pauline Nash (October), Nicholas Goldsworthy (November) and Fiona Nick (December).
